Output 284b35bb5a1223c031188b617845652f06f0190ad2b7dabe765af8d5aaffe33d:0

value
6352664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703256c58572601f25105e8d8793f59be47d5873 OP_EQUAL
address
3BvFue6e2ScxCATrNUawV3MW75fpnPPz4d
transaction
284b35bb5a1223c031188b617845652f06f0190ad2b7dabe765af8d5aaffe33d
confirmations
459282
spent
true